Output 21ed359a13d22f5a4a4e3d90ad6316d96f633bde657d5d32f55d5cc774fe052d:0

value
1000003
script pubkey
OP_0 OP_PUSHBYTES_20 67d8f2b617bef1fc8e1806c335749937f0717295
address
bc1qvlv09dshhmclerscqmpn2ayexlc8zu54lp4ph3
transaction
21ed359a13d22f5a4a4e3d90ad6316d96f633bde657d5d32f55d5cc774fe052d
confirmations
37842
spent
true